2022 PSBA ANNUAL MEMBERS’ EXHIBITION

Open for Online Submissions

Tuesday, March 15

As a member of PSBA you are invited to participate in the 2022 PSBA Annual Exhibition.  This year's suggested theme is Peaks and Valleys. Peaks and Valleys invoke many connotations.  We encourage members to explore their own highs and lows, literal and metaphorical.

Worried that a work you planned to submit doesn’t fit the theme? It’s possible that a work originally created without the theme in mind may still fit the theme by turning a phrase or rethinking the original intent of the book.  This, of course, is at the artist’s discretion.

Submission Guidelines

  • Artist must be a current member of PSBA.  If you are a high school or college student, your membership is free this year.

  • Submitted entries must consist of work dated 2018 or later.

  • Submitted entries may not have been exhibited in a previous PSBA annual exhibit.

  • A $10 entry fee is payable upon submitting your entry.  If you are a student this fee will be waived.

  • The artist may submit up to three works with the guarantee that at least one work will be included in the exhibition. Space constraints will determine if more than one work by an artist will be accepted for exhibition.
